Minutes — Branch Management Meeting, Tarsen Retail Co.

Attendees: branch managers, ops lead, controller.

Decision: write down seasonal inventory in the Glenmoor and Patchway branches following the failed Solstice line launch. Write-down booked this quarter; no restatement needed. Branch managers to clear affected stock via outlet channel only — no in-store markdowns. Controller to circulate revised shrinkage targets. Questions route through ops lead. The forward plan driving this decision appears below.

confidential, kagup-bafog: Fraaxax Group is in early talks to buy Soroxox Group for about $343.8 million. The Olidor launch date is June 14, and nothing goes to the press before then. Legal wants the Aldmirek Logistics term sheet signed before July 23.

### Checklist: turnstile counter audit (Gate C rollout)

Before we ship the new Spindrift counter firmware to Bramble Park Arena, please sanity-check the overflow handling — the old unit wrapped at 65,535 and security got phantom "mass exit" alerts mid-match. Confirm counts are monotonic per session, reset only on signed command, and that the tamper line still trips when the housing opens. Yes, it's boring; it's also the thing auditors ask about first. Verify you're reviewing the exact build named by the token below.

session token of kafof-kafop = htk31_c3becf8b8eac3ed970037fba36e258e

## GPU memory profiling — Oxbow release checks

Before signing off a release, run the Oxbow profiler against the canary pool for at least one full inference cycle. Confirm that peak allocation stays under the budget recorded in the last baseline, and that fragmentation warnings remain below threshold. The profiler must be invoked with the exact configuration used in the prior release, reproduced below.

settings of yageg-yahap:
[gorael]
team = olieth
access_code = ac_941d74
owner = brieth.aldiel
host = gorael.tolvaqio.internal
port = 6379
peer = briwyn.urlaqtech.internal
salt = 116e6622
pin = 1957